A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the procurement of six units of a fairing for aircraft fuselage, identified by NSN 1560-01-606-6281 and part number 70215-42402-052, under solicitation SPE4A6-26-T-48L0. The delivery is scheduled with a 169-day lead time, with a required ship date of November 1, 2026, and a final delivery date of March 31, 2027. The items are to be delivered FOB origin to the DLA Distribution Center at New Cumberland, Pennsylvania. Packaging and handling must comply with DLA master list technical and quality requirements, including strict adherence to specified military and ASTM standards for hazardous and non-hazardous materials, labeling under MIL-STD-129, and palletization as per DLA packaging directive RP001. The contract includes a range of quality control and cybersecurity requirements, such as Cybersecurity Maturity Model Certification (CMMC) Level 2 self-assessment, configuration change management, marking and identification of bare items, and specific inspection and acceptance criteria at the destination point. The supplier must follow Sikorsky Corporation's alternate sampling plan, which aligns with or exceeds industry standards ASQ H1331 or MIL-STD-1916. Transportation instructions reference DLA procurement notes for shipping and handling to ensure compliance. The contract is managed by the ASC Commodities Division of the Department of Defense, with Zachary Gonzalez as the primary point of contact.
